Evelyn Knapp, co-founder of Personal Training Institute, spent a lifetime promoting exercise and proper nutrition to thousands. Her knowledge, motivation and dedication helped inspire countless individuals to engage in a healthier lifestyle. After being diagnosed with breast cancer, Evelyn continued exercising throughout treatment. She would say it gave her a feeling of control in an uncontrollable situation. From there she made a new commitment to promote exercise for cancer patients so they, too, would experience the benefits. In 2005 Evelyn lost her battle with breast cancer. However, her mission was not lost. Strength for Life was formed in Evelyn’s memory so we may continue her work and make her vision a reality.
Strength for Life is a 501 (c) 3 charitable organization providing free exercise classes and wellness weekends to cancer patients and survivors.

Team PTI joined hundreds of cyclists on September 11th for the 2010 bikeMS: Twin Forks Ride to help fight multiple sclerosis. This was Team PTI’s first ride for Multiple Sclerosis. After working with several clients who suffer from MS and seeing how exercise and healthy eating can greatly improve quality of life, Personal Training Institute decided this was a cause they had to be involved in. Team PTI had a great time supporting The National Multiple Sclerosis Society and exceeded their fund raising goal by 25%! Thank you to everyone who participated and donated.
